Industrial design students need a laptop capable of handling 3D modeling, rendering, and design software efficiently. Here are the top recommendations based on performance, portability, and value.
1. Apple MacBook Pro 16″ (M3 Max) – Best for macOS Users
This system offers exceptional performance, long battery life, and a color-accurate display, making it an excellent choice for creative professionals and students alike. Powered by the Apple M3 Max processor, it comes with 32GB+ of RAM and a 1TB SSD+, ensuring rapid processing and ample storage for large projects. Its integrated GPU is capable of handling 3D modeling and rendering efficiently, making it ideal for running macOS-based applications like Adobe Suite, Rhino, Blender, or KeyShot

2. Dell XPS 17 (2024) – Best Windows Alternative
A laptop with powerful hardware and a large, color-accurate display is essential for professionals working with CAD-based software like SolidWorks and Fusion 360. Equipped with an Intel Core i9 processor (13th or 14th Gen), it delivers exceptional processing power for handling complex 3D models and simulations. With 32GB or more of RAM, multitasking and running demanding applications become seamless. The inclusion of a 1TB SSD ensures fast storage access, reducing load times and enhancing workflow efficiency. Additionally, the NVIDIA RTX 4070 graphics card provides outstanding rendering capabilities, making it ideal for detailed design work. This combination of high-end specifications ensures smooth performance, precision, and reliability for engineering and design professionals.
3. ASUS ProArt Studio book 16 OLED – Best for Creators
An OLED touchscreen with a built-in dial provides precise controls, making it an excellent choice for professionals involved in high-resolution rendering and color-accurate design work. Powered by an AMD Ryzen 9 or Intel Core i9 processor, this laptop delivers exceptional performance for handling complex creative tasks. With 32GB or more of RAM, users can seamlessly multitask and work on large design files without slowdowns. A 1TB SSD ensures fast storage access, quick file transfers, and improved workflow efficiency. Additionally, the NVIDIA RTX 4070 or 4080 graphics card enhances rendering capabilities, offering smooth performance for detailed visual work. This combination of high-end features makes it an ideal choice for digital artists, graphic designers, and creative professionals who demand precision and efficiency.
4. Lenovo ThinkPad P16 Gen 2 – Best Workstation Laptop
Designed for professionals who require reliability and workstation-class power, this laptop is built to handle the most demanding tasks with ease. Featuring an Intel Core i9 (13th Gen) processor, it delivers exceptional computing power for heavy CAD work, 3D rendering, and complex simulations. With 32GB or more of RAM, it ensures seamless multitasking and smooth performance when working with large datasets. The 1TB SSD provides ample storage and rapid data access, reducing load times and enhancing workflow efficiency. Equipped with an NVIDIA RTX A5000 graphics card, this system offers top-tier GPU acceleration for rendering, modeling, and simulation applications. This combination of high-performance hardware makes it an ideal choice for engineers, architects, and designers who need precision, stability, and powerful computing capabilities.
5. Razer Blade 16 (2024) – Best for GPU Power
Offering extreme GPU power in a sleek and portable design, this laptop is engineered for industrial designers who require real-time rendering and heavy graphical processing. Powered by an Intel Core i9 (14th Gen) processor, it delivers top-tier performance for handling complex design tasks with ease. With 32GB or more of RAM, users can work on large-scale projects without experiencing slowdowns. The 1TB SSD ensures lightning-fast storage access, reducing load times and improving workflow efficiency. Equipped with an NVIDIA RTX 4090 graphics card, this system provides unparalleled rendering capabilities, making it perfect for high-end 3D modeling, simulations, and visualizations. Combining power, portability, and precision, this laptop is an ideal choice for professionals who need cutting-edge performance on the go.

Desktop Alternative: Apple Mac Studio or Custom PC Build
For students working from a fixed location, a Mac Studio (M3 Ultra) or a custom-built PC with an AMD Ryzen 9 7950X + NVIDIA RTX 4090 provides ultimate performance for rendering and simulation.
